Core & Main (CNM) Is Up 5.0% After Buybacks, M&A Pipeline Updates and Guidance Reaffirmation - Has The Bull Case Changed?

In its fiscal 2026 second quarter, Core & Main, Inc. reported higher year-on-year sales of US$2,145 million and net income of US$144 million, reaffirmed full-year guidance for US$7.80–US$7.90 billion in net sales, accelerated share repurchases under its existing program, and highlighted a more active acquisition pipeline progressing to letters of intent.
